LUKOIL INTENDS TO EXPAND IN BULGARIA

Business | September 27, 2001, Thursday // 00:00

The Russian-registered oil company LUKoil said yesterday that it is willing to bid for the privatization of Bulgaria`s energetics, it transpired yesterday after LUKoil president Vagit Alekperov met Premier Simeon Saxe-Coburg. `We`ll increase our investments in Bulgaria,` Alekperov said further to the PM. Their meeting in the Council of Ministers office building lasted 45 minutes. Russia`s ambassador to Bulgaria Vladimir Titov and Director General of LUKoil-Bulgaria Valentin Zlatev also attended the meeting. `We talked of LUKoil`s activities in Bulgaria and of Neftochim refinery, as well as of the retailers` markets we are to expand on,` Vagit Alekperov added. The company is to invest $100 million more in Bulgaria. From 30,000 to 50,000 tons of oil products, produced in Bulgaria, will be exported to the USA per month, Alekperov elaborated.
